Output d5febe9a8b130790134705abe9805b1dcdb394fcaad5ed8e18a16c9696467d09:1

value
19234967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bdd6957c66b9e371fe0d478d75b3c0a66714ce OP_EQUAL
address
MTfBc4DNS1CBBHwo62F9w5FZQFZ6zUqrMT
transaction
d5febe9a8b130790134705abe9805b1dcdb394fcaad5ed8e18a16c9696467d09
spent
true